The following is an outline of the steps to be performed in function main. For example : 3, 5 , 5, 7 , 11, 13 … import java. Below is a sample program to illustrate the Sieve of Eratosthenes. If at any time, we get the remainder as zero, we conclude that the number is not prime. If the remainder is zero, then the number is a factor. You can see why 2 is the only prime. Example : 2, 3, 5, 7, 11, 13, 17…… Note : 0 and 1 are not prime numbers.
A prime number has only two factors, namely one and itself. The algorithm would then … Read more » If no previous prime divides a num, then that num is a prime. We are using sqrt method of Math package which find square root of a number. The flag is a boolean variable which is used to identify whether the number passed or failed the Prime number condition for every iteration. Other than these two number it has no positive divisor. We can further reduce this upper limit by noting that a number has no other factors except itself greater than sqrt n.
Method 1 It is the simplest approach to check whether a number is prime or not. If you are interested in programming do subscribe to our E-mail newsletter for all programming tutorials. Elapsed: 4879 millis Using Sieve of Eratosthenes will give even more dramatic improvements: import java. This is pretty useful when encrypting a password. A very important question in mathematics and security is telling whether a number is prime or not. If we are able to find atleast one other factor, then we can conclude that the number is not prime. How to check prime number in Java.
Elapsed: 4879 millis Using Sieve of Eratosthenes will give even more dramatic improvements: import java. Which is around 400 times faster than the original code! On the one hand, it is used to collect, store, and print the output data. Talk to your teacher and consider taking a more rudimentary course. Hope this article will help you to understand the concept of f inding the number is prime or not. Thus to test a number m for primality, one need only do trial divisions by prime numbers less than m.
Java Program To Find Initial 10 or 20 or 30 or 40 … n Prime Numbers : Program : import java. For example : 3, 5 , 5, 7 , 11, 13 … import java. With a team of 10+ authors we would do our best to explain whatever the topic in a simple way. The next question is what is the range of numbers we need to consider while checking if they are factors? You can here for more information. So, the condition is True, and the number is Prime Number Java Program to Check Prime Number using While Loop This program will check whether the given number is a Prime number or not using. To determine whether a given number is prime, we need to check if it has factors others than one and itself.
Submitted by IncludeHelp, on December 11, 2017 Given range starting and end numbers and we have to print the all prime numbers between the range using java program. The array argument P will contain a sufficient number of primes to do the testing. So, compiler will come out of the For Loop. Trying to learn Java, or trying to program algorithms? Next, it will check whether the given number is a Prime number or Not using. One need only do trial divisions of m by primes p in the range 2 p m. You don't appear to understand either what the program is supposed to do, or how to write a program that might satisfy the requirements, and nothing we say here can overcome that - you have to develop more understanding of math and programming. The flag is a boolean variable which is used to identify whether the number passed or failed the Prime number condition for every iteration.
And we run it 10,000 times to have a large execution time. See examples on the webpage. Since, a number is definitely not divisible by any number greater than itself, we can place n as the upper limit. The return value in this case would be false since 11 divides 143. Java Program To Check Given Number Is Prime Or Not : Program : import java. If the command line argument is not a single positive integer, your program will print a usage message as specified in the examples below, then exit.
Prime number is a whole number which is greater than 1 and is divisible only by 1 and itself. Slightly different intent, but from here you can extract the test. Next, it will enter into If statement. Prime Number Programs In Java : Below is the list of some of the prime number programs in java. However, 1 is neither a prime nor composite number.
Your program, which will be called Prime. If A is not divisible by any value A-1 to 2 , except itself it is a prime number. If at any time, we get the remainder as zero, we conclude that the number is not prime. If you need to write a program that needs to check if a number if prime or not, below are some examples for Prime Number Program in Java. Description: A prime number or a prime is a natural number greater than 1 that has no positive divisors other than 1 and itself.